Top-seeded Kevin Anderson quits Delray Beach Open

Top-seeded Kevin Anderson quit his first-round match at the Delray Beach Open because of an injured right shoulder.

Anderson had just dropped the first set to 103rd-ranked American Austin Krajicek in a tiebreaker when he headed to the sideline. He packed his racket bag, shook his opponent's hand, tossed some used wristbands into the crowd and walked off.

Del Potro wins return match against Kudla at Delray Beach

Juan Martin del Potro was stuck with too much idle time the past two seasons, limited to 14 matches in that span because of a series of wrist injuries.

So when the 2009 U.S. Open champion was asked about his second-round opponent in the Delray Beach Open, del Potro shrugged his shoulders and deadpanned: ''I don't know him. For two years I was at home, watching `The Simpsons.'''

It was quite a night for the 27-year-old del Potro, who beat American Denis Kudla 6-1, 6-4 on Tuesday in his first ATP match in 11 months.

Ram, Querrey set up all-American final at Delray Beach Open

The 2016 Delray Beach Open has become the theater of the unexpected with upsets all week. And it happened again on a sunny, mild Saturday at the Delray Beach Stadium and Tennis Center.

Rajeev Ram, a well-known and highly successful doubles specialist, proved he could a win again on a singles court as he dominated the fourth-seeded Grigor Dimitrov in the first semifinal, 6-4, 6-3, in just over an hour on Stadium Court.

In the evening semifinal, American Sam Querrey derailed Juan Martin Del Potro’s comeback on the ATP tour, defeating the 2011 Delray champion, 7-5, 7-5.

Sam Querrey Beats Rajeev Ram in Delray Beach Open Final

Sam Querrey beat Rajeev Ram 6-4, 7-6 (8-6) on Sunday in an all-American final in the Delray Beach Open for his eighth ATP World Tour title and first since 2012.

Querrey rebounded from a break down in each set and 0-3, 2-5 and 5-6 in the tiebreaker before closing out Ram with a running forehand down-the-line pass that clipped the baseline. Ram challenged the call, but the replay showed it caught the outside of the line.
